This article aims at analyzing the role of the objects of learning in the propositions for innovation of primary schools during the 20th century, highlighting the changes in the composition of school subjects having in mind the objects that were introduced and marked out as relevant for school modernization and those that remained or were redefined in terms of their finality and uses. The examination of three significant moments of the implementation of innovations in the elementary school is intended: the modernization by the intuitive method at the turn of the century; the propositions of Escola Nova between the 1930s and the 1950s; and the renovation represented by educational technology in the 1960s and 1970s.

This article analyzes the ideas and the work of Ansio Teixeira in the 1920s and 1930s, focusing on his views about the value of measurement for educational reform in Brazil. Considering that the thinking and practices of Teixeira should be understood in the context in which it was developed, the study presents the history of the presence of psychological knowledge in education, with special attention to the entrance of the Psychometrics in the New School movement. The paper concludes that, by defending the use of measurement, Teixeira has remained true to the goal of the New School that required to diagnoses scientifically the school universe, which was necessary to respond to the growing demand for schooling and the educational disabilities of the Brazilian educational institutions.

In search of Brazil's entry into modernity, educators pledged to develop mechanisms for the construction of the brazilian man, and modern. Thales Castanho de Andrade was one of those educators who found in the educational destination book this possibility. This article is concerned to examine the ways that are served by reading books models of urban life to cite the country life. These books are part of the Coleo de leitura escolar: srie Thales de Andrade. The books carry a model school reading ideologized as they meet, in addition to teaching reading, build civility of the countryside, through images or words, or the organization that goes through all the books of the collection.

Aiming to contribute to understanding the Brazilian academic production on literacy, theses and dissertations on the subject, completed between 1965 and 2011, are analyzed. Situating them in the historical process of constitution of literacy as an object of study, since the 19th. century, beyond the political and historical context of origin in the 1960s, the following contexts are focused, especially from the 1980s, when begins the process of expansion in terms of amount of this academic production and geographic diversity as well as areas of expertise of the graduate programs in which they were defended. While these advances confirm the importance of approaches that consider the interdisciplinary and multifaceted character of literacy, there are contradictions that present significant challenges to researchers seeking both understand the permanence of motivations and pragmatic purposes as to proposing new themes, objects, theoretical and methodological aspects for the development of new research that are lacking, as diagnosed needs and desired progress, scientifically and socially.

Este trabalho visa explorar o ensino da matemtica por meio da anlise de livros didticos do aluno e do professor entre as dcadas de 1960 e 1980, focando o 1 ano do ensino primrio, atual fundamental I. Iniciamos por uma reviso bibliogrfica sobre o contexto histrico, desde a introduo do livro na sociedade at a utilizao do mesmo para o ensino na rea da matemtica. A pesquisa tentar retratar brevemente, a história da educação e da educação matemtica no Brasil, as diferentes concepes de ensino da poca em questo, ou seja, entre as dcadas de 1960 e 1980, onde houve o pice e o declnio do Movimento da Matemtica Moderna. Por fim, este trabalho buscar explorar de maneira panormica, se ocorreram mudanas nos contedos no ensino da matemtica por meio da anlise de livros didticos do aluno e do professor no 1 ano das sries iniciais e relatar quais foram essas mudanas. Utilizar-se- como metodologia a anlise de livros didticos como um objeto pertencente história cultural, com um enfoque na anlise scio-histrica, na anlise formal ou discursiva e, finalmente, interpretao/ reinterpretao.

Pela Lei Federal n 11.274/2006, promulgada em seis de fevereiro de 2006, o ensino fundamental no Brasil passa a ter a durao de nove anos, com a incluso de crianas de seis anos de idade. O objetivo desta Lei assegurar um tempo maior de convvio escolar e maiores oportunidades de aprendizagem, principalmente s crianas pertencentes aos setores populares. O presente trabalho tem por objetivo analisar a lei que estende a obrigatoriedade, do ensino fundamental e traar um panorama deste processo de ampliao no municpio de Pirassununga, buscando conhecer sua trajetria, bem como os aspectos positivos e negativos oriundos da nova legislao. Para alcanar os objetivos propostos a pesquisa se desenvolveu a partir de levantamento bibliogrfico, bem como no levantamento de dados e informaes acerca do municpio de Pirassununga e tambm atravs de documentos oficiais, entrevista do tipo semi-estruturada, e pesquisa em sites governamentais, relacionados com o tema. A ampliao do ensino fundamental para nove anos culmina numa ampliao de direitos, ainda que tmida, que vem sendo perseguida ao longo da história da educação brasileira. Entretanto, esta ampliao tem suscitado inmeros questionamentos e criticas ao que refere a qualidade do ensino e a preocupao com os aportes financeiros

In present article, we present reflections on the process of closing public schools in the countryside in Brazil. Through bibliographical survey, as well as documental research, we carried out a retrospective analysis of the historical moment in which the implementation of policies of mass education directed to people living in rural areas occurs. We have also sought to raise socio-political-economic aspects of the moment in which the process of closing these schools is intensified. The results obtained suggest possible implications of this closure policy, in addition to indicating some of the challenges posed to the public policy of education in the country; for example, the Brazilian federal context and the budget limitations imposed to subnational governments with regard to the funding of school education, particularly in relation to small municipalities and/or municipalities with low tax revenues. This situation quite often occurs because these municipalities present reduced budgets, depending largely on transfers of financial resources from other spheres of the Government, either federal or state, the so-called intergovernmental budgetary transfers; namely, the Municipalities Participation Fund. Such issues demand the resumption of debates about the federative pact, in particular with regard to fiscal federalism, given that the financial capacity of each subnational government is crucial to the implementation of educational policies.

O artigo analisa aspectos das relaes entre a escolarizaoe os processos culturais mais amplos, tomando como fontedocumental manuais didticos produzidos para uso em cursos deformao de professores, que circularam no Brasil e em Portugalno perodo final do sculo XIX e no incio do sculo XX. Foramfocalizados elementos passveis de generalizao, entre eles aunidade da forma escolar e as diferentes prticas prescritas aosprofessores, destinadas a enraizar valores e ideais no processoformativo. Foram analisados os seguintes manuais: CursoPractico de Pedagogia, de autoria de Mr. Daligault (1874);Elementos de Pedagogia, de autoria de Jose Maria da GraaAffreixo e Henrique Freire (1870); e Lies de pedagogia gerale de história da educação, de Alberto Pimentel Filho (1932).

This article, about reflections on the condition of Brazilian women from the Colony to the first decades of the twentieth century, reveals the historical position of them and the attitudes and behaviors related to gender and sexuality. Subdued, it was treated as a sexual object, arousing all sorts of misogyny by men. Rebel, veiled or ostensibly, could serve their own desires. Throughout history, the Church and medical institutions which jointly accounted for, significantly, established the meaning and place of women. In Colony period, the woman is a ward from the Catholic ideology, but from the nineteenth century, after Independence, this power control arises to Medicine. The physician submits the religious discourse, naturalizing the status of women as one that breeds, namely the insertion of the medical issues of family scientifically legitimate colonial patriarchy. This is accentuated in the early twentieth century, when medicine consolidated setting standards and rules for marriage, to motherhood and family life. We note how the feminine universe was (and it is nowadays) ambivalent, with "one foot" in virtue and another in sin, with a tendency to contain and another to trespass. On the one hand we have the home and motherhood, validated in marriage, in which the woman is cared for and dependent on her husband. Reflecting on the motherhood of Virgin Mary, comes to the sacred dimension of the idealized woman saint by the Church. At the same time, however, feels the need for freedom, identity and independence, needing to give a voice to the desire to have their sexuality and all that it is due in full. The manifestation of the desire and the call for sexual satisfaction, and put in permanent conflict personal, psychological and social split between moral entrenched across generations and cultural transformations resulting from decades of the 20th Century.
